Mow The Backyard First | A Lesson In Leadership

My great-grandfather held a type of practical, country wisdom that seems to be fading from this world.

He carried with him several rules for living and one of those was stated without any elaboration, “Mow the backyard first.”

If you’re not a leader, then you may simply glaze over this as a preference of an old man. But any astute leader can see the complex lessons wrapped in this simple package.


Do the Hard Thing First

With any job there’s a certain percentage that we love doing, that’s easy to do… those things where we know we can knock it out of the park.

But then there’s that 20% or so that we dread. It takes more effort. It’s not glamorous. There’s no praise involved. But, it’s a necessary evil for achieving our overall success.

Do that first. Why?

If you mow the front lawn first, and it gets late, you get tired, someone comes along with a pleasant distraction, you’ll put off the backyard. After all, not so many people ever see the backyard. Then the backyard, somehow, ends up not getting mowed that week.

If you mow the backyard first and it gets late, you get tired, or someone comes along with a temptation, you’ll push yourself to get the front yard finished. You wouldn’t want the neighbors to think you were trashy or lazy.

In leadership, there are difficulties.

Have that tough conversation early. Then you don’t spend all day anxious about it or distracted thinking about it.

Tackle that unpleasant account first. Then if you have to stay late, at least you’re working on one of your more gratifying accounts.

Leaders Develop Teams

If you’re in a leadership position, or if you’re leading through influence, help others mow their back yards too. Work is always easier with a team.
